Zmiany struktury fitocenoz stawów bobrowych

2021
The study compared the habitat conditions and species composition of phytocoenosis between beaver ponds in different age categories: 5−10 years, 11−15 years and older than 15 years. The survey was conducted on 11 beaver ponds located on various watercourses in northern Poland. Prior to flooding, an alder stand was present at all sites.

Fitocenoze obične smreke (Picea abies Karst.) u altimontanskom i subalpskom pojasu Hrvatske = Phytocoenoses of common spruce(Picea abies Karst.) in the altimontane and subalpine belt of Croatia

Glasnik za šumske pokuse, 2011
Three associations of common spruce in the altimontane and subalpine belt of the Croatian Dinaric Mountain range have been described using the Central European phytocoenological method (Braun-Blanquet 1964). These associations differ in terms of ecological conditions, floral composition, and partially of their distribution range.
